Who wins Spain’s €818m storage programme? The companies behind 9.4 GWh

The final resolution of Spain’s FEDER programme redraws the country’s storage map. Total funding was reduced, major players such as Aquila Capital exited the scheme, while new large-scale projects from RWE and Alter Enersun entered the portfolio. The outcome also brought a strong regional reshuffle, with Catalonia, Extremadura and the Canary Islands emerging as key beneficiaries of the changes.
